|claim=The author states, "Facsimile 2, Figure #5 states the sun gets its light from Kolob. We now know that the process of nuclear fusion is what makes the stars and suns shine. With the discovery of quantum mechanics, scientists learned that the sun’s source of energy is internal, and not external. The sun shines because of thermonuclear fusion; not because it gets its light from any other star as claimed by the Book of Abraham." | |claim=The author states, "Facsimile 2, Figure #5 states the sun gets its light from Kolob. *Joseph did not say that "the sun gets its light from Kolob," he said "this is one of the governing planets also, and is said by the Egyptians to be the Sun, and '''to borrow its light from Kolob through the medium of Kae-e-vanrash'''."
